Output 892342ec6388d99a24446afe6a62996f218f99db1fee43b7aa51fe543c05c884:3

value
21760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6df64bd85ec7b7dbecbaae5a39173de4b1d27db8 OP_EQUAL
address
MHvawJcqnrt2VN3zCVVJ7opEfVCPz6Z54o
transaction
892342ec6388d99a24446afe6a62996f218f99db1fee43b7aa51fe543c05c884
spent
true